Definition of Membrane Buttons



Membrane buttons, which are extensively used in various electronic tools, are a sort of individual interface that includes numerous layers, consisting of a visuals overlay, a spacer, and a printed circuit layer. These buttons are created to offer a seamless communication between the user and the tool, facilitating input with pressure-sensitive innovation. The graphic overlay presents symbols or message that lead the individual in making selections, while the spacer layer divides the graphic overlay from the circuit layer, making sure that the switch activates just when pushed.


The printed circuit layer has conductive traces that link to the device's circuitry, signing up user input. When stress is put on the overlay, it presses the spacer and bridges the conductive traces, finishing an electrical circuit. This system enables a efficient and reliable ways of input in a portable form aspect.


Membrane buttons are commonly discovered in applications such as clinical devices, consumer electronic devices, and industrial tools, where resilience and convenience of usage are critical. Their layout can be customized to fit details applications, making them a useful and versatile choice for suppliers seeking to boost individual communication with their products.


Advantages of Membrane Buttons



Making use of Membrane Switches offers numerous advantages that enhance both customer experience and tool functionality. One of the primary benefits is their portable layout, allowing for the combination of several features within a restricted space. This is especially useful in applications where real estate is at a premium, such as portable gadgets and clinical devices.


In addition, Membrane switches are immune and long lasting to ecological aspects, including wetness, dirt, and chemicals. This durability not only prolongs the life of the device however likewise makes sure constant performance in challenging conditions, consequently enhancing individual dependability.


The tactile feedback supplied by Membrane buttons can substantially improve individual interaction. By providing an unique sensation upon activation, they help customers verify activities without requiring visual confirmation, simplifying the procedure process.


In addition, Membrane switches are less complicated to maintain and clean up than standard mechanical switches, lowering the overall price of ownership. Their smooth surfaces minimize the buildup of dust and pollutants, promoting health in food-related or medical applications.

Enhancing Tactile Feedback



A considerable facet of customer experience in electronic devices is the tactile comments given by controls. Membrane switches can considerably improve this comments, making sure that customers obtain a satisfying response when interacting with a device. The discover here incorporation of functions such as dome Switches within Membrane designs enables a distinct tactile experience, developing a receptive feel that guarantees customers of their actions.


The tactile comments offered by Membrane buttons can be adjusted to suit specific applications. By adjusting the products and dome forms, makers can produce varying levels of resistance and actuation force, permitting a customized user experience. This flexibility provides to diverse user choices and functional requirements, enhancing total tool functionality.




Additionally, effective responsive comments minimizes the probability of input errors, as customers can a lot more precisely determine when a switch has been triggered.
